New Candidate Umpire Training Class
The NCMBUA is currently looking for new umpire candidates for the 2023 training class. Similar to 2022 there will be multiple sessions of the classroom running right up through the start of the baseball season. The training consists of virtual classes, mechanics clinics and a state certified exam. Session 1 is scheduled for Mondays and will begin Monday 2/27/2023 and run for 5 total classes 2 hours each from 6:30pm to 8:30pm and a mechanics clinic. The cost for the class is $125. Upon completion of the class new umpires will be certified to umpire all amateur levels of baseball from MIAA high school varsity and sub-varsity, including AAU down to Little League and Cal Ripken as well as summer leagues such as Sr. Ruth, Legion and Stan Musial men's leagues.

North Central Massachusetts Baseball Umpire Association
About Us
Based in the Northern Worcester County area, ncmbua.org is a member assocation of the MBUA and facilitates the education, training, assessment, and scheduling of officials. By doing so, we proudly promote fair play, competition, and the increased enjoyment of athletics by players, fans, and participants alike.
